Find a psychiatrist in Glasgow

You may need a medical professional to help you if you suffer from an illness of the mind. Psychiatrists are specially trained doctors who specialize in treating mental disorders. They are able to prescribe medication and recommend alternative treatments for patients. They are employed in clinics or hospitals and are typically part of a mental health community team. They may also provide psychotherapy to treat certain conditions.

In some cases psychiatrists may also provide advice and support to relatives and friends of those suffering from a mental illness. They can help them deal with the symptoms and understand the struggles their loved ones go through. Many people who suffer from mental illnesses find that they can enhance their quality of life after seeking psychiatric help. Some psychiatrists might be capable of suggesting treatments that can help ease some of the symptoms, such as psychotherapy or cognitive behavior therapy, which is called CBT.

Psychiatrists are different from other mental health professionals due to the fact that they can prescribe medications as well as practice therapy. They may also participate in the diagnosis of mental illness through physical examinations, conducting blood tests and the interpretation of brain scans and laboratory scans, such as CT or MRI.
